The local schools have high standards. How can a tutor help my child keep up and stand out?

We understand the pressure to achieve top grades. A one-to-one tutor can give your child a competitive edge by creating a learning plan that targets their specific areas for improvement. This focused support helps them build a deep understanding of subjects, improve their exam technique, and grow the confidence to stand out.

My child hopes to apply to universities like Keele or Staffordshire. Can a tutor help with that?

Absolutely. Many of our tutors have experience helping students with their UCAS applications. They can provide support with A-Level subjects, offer guidance on personal statement writing, and even conduct mock interviews to help your child feel prepared and confident.

How do I choose the right tutor for my child in Uttoxeter?

It's simple to find the perfect match. You can filter tutors by subject, level, and price. Watch their introductory videos, read reviews from other parents, and send a message to a few to see who feels like the best fit before booking. It's all about finding someone your child will connect with.

What if my child doesn't click with their first tutor?

Your peace of mind is our priority. If for any reason the first lesson isn't a perfect fit, let us know. If you don't get on with your tutor, email our support team at support@tutorful.co.uk and we will cover your first session with a new tutor.

Are all the tutors background-checked?

Yes, your child's safety is incredibly important to us. Every single tutor on our platform has passed an enhanced DBS check. We are also very selective, accepting only 1 in 8 tutors who apply, so you can be sure your child is learning from the best.

How much does online tutoring cost?

Our tutors set their own hourly rates, typically starting from around £20 per hour. Prices vary based on the tutor's experience and the subject level. You can easily filter by price to find an excellent tutor who fits your family's budget.

How does online tutoring actually work?

All lessons take place in our purpose-built online classroom. It features a video chat, an interactive whiteboard, and the ability to share documents and past papers. It's a secure and effective way for your child to learn from the comfort of your home.

Can a tutor help my child if they've lost their confidence?

Definitely. A lack of confidence is one of the most common reasons parents seek a tutor. The one-to-one attention in a supportive, patient environment helps your child feel safe to ask questions and make mistakes, which is often the key to rebuilding their self-belief.

Is this just for school subjects, or can my child learn other skills?

While we cover all academic subjects from Primary to A-Level, we also have talented tutors who can teach skills like coding, learning a musical instrument like the guitar, or even public speaking. It's a great way to support your child's hobbies and interests too.

What subjects do your tutors in Uttoxeter cover?

Our online tutors cover over 300 subjects. Whether your child needs help with core GCSE subjects like Maths, English, and Science, or support with A-Levels, languages, or humanities, you'll find an expert tutor to help.

How long are the tutoring sessions?

The standard session length is one hour, as this is usually the most effective for maintaining focus. However, you can discuss your child's needs with your tutor, and they may be able to arrange shorter or longer sessions if required.

How quickly can we get started?

You can get started very quickly. Many of our tutors can offer a lesson within a few days. Simply find a tutor you like, send them a message to arrange a time, and you can have your first session booked in no time.
